Vice President - Regulatory Reporting Change & Controls Lead Analyst (Mumbai)
Citigroup
**Team/Function Overview:**
The Operations Regulatory Control group is a centralized unit within ICG O&T that is responsible for the implementation and oversight of regulatory reporting, including exception management and risk mitigation across swap dealer reporting. The group is responsible for:
+ Implementation of new regulatory reporting initiatives and enhancements
+ Control and exception management on swap dealer reports
+ Industry level advocacy across multiple trade associations
+ Partnering across Markets to remediate regulatory issues
